ABSTRACT:
An energy measurement system (“EMS”) and techniques for correlating energy consumption to computing system activity. The EMS includes a data acquisition module, a processing module, and optionally a visualization module. The data acquisition module receives and transmits to the processing unit a number of sampled data streams, referred to as “data acquisition traces,” associated with a computing system under test (“SUT”). The processing module concurrently receives one or more system traces from the SUT, which are produced by particular components under examination by the EMS. Synchronization is established between the data acquisition traces and the system trace(s) when the SUT executes certain predetermined actions to produce data in both the data acquisition traces and the system trace(s), which data is used to logically align the traces. Then, as test scenarios are executed by the SUT, changes are monitored in the traces, and energy consumption is quantified.
